Started renovations today. Carpet pulled out. 6 boxes of VC tile sitting on standby. Walls primed and patched for a new color.

Been using a 36" x 80" solid core door setup for my main workbench. Building a 3-section workbench (so I can take it apart or move easily) to span one of the 10ft walls. Going with a 24" deep setup this time as 36" was just too much. Going to use 2x4's for the frames and solid core doors (cut to size) for the tops again.

Each section will serve its own purpose; main bench, paint booth bench and reloading bench.
